Iron in PDB 7plb: Caulobacter Crescentus Xylonolactonase with D-Xylose
Enzymatic activity of Caulobacter Crescentus Xylonolactonase with D-Xylose
All present enzymatic activity of Caulobacter Crescentus Xylonolactonase with D-Xylose:
3.1.1.68;
Protein crystallography data
The structure of Caulobacter Crescentus Xylonolactonase with D-Xylose, PDB code: 7plb
was solved by
J.Paakkonen,
N.Hakulinen,
J.Rouvinen,
with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:
Resolution Low / High (Å)
|
85.47 /
1.73
|
Space group
|
C 2 2 21
|
Cell size a, b, c (Å), α, β, γ (°)
|
85.84,
170.95,
79.14,
90,
90,
90
|
R / Rfree (%)
|
18.1 /
21.8
|
